#f8d6cd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#f8d6cd is composed of 97.3% red, 83.9% green and 80.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 13.7% magenta, 17.3% yellow and 2.7% black. It has a hue angle of 12.6 degrees, a saturation of 75.4% and a lightness of 88.8%. #f8d6cd color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#f1ad9b. Closest websafe color is: #ffcccc.

#f8d6cd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#f8d6cd has RGB values of R:248, G:214, B:205 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.14, Y:0.17, K:0.03. Its decimal value is 16307917.
